The Role
As a Senior Program Manager for Data Engineering , you will lead program execution across a portfolio of high-impact initiatives within GM’s Data Engineering organization (e.g., Device Data Capture, Vehicle Data Engineering, AV Data, Customer & Marketing, Data Governance).
In this highly visible, cross-functional role, you will drive complex, large-scale software engineering programs from concept through delivery – partnering closely with engineering, product, and executive stakeholders. You will play a critical role in shaping roadmaps, establishing scalable governance models, and driving disciplined execution to deliver high-quality, data-driven solutions that power GM’s next-generation vehicles and services.
What You’ll Do
-
Lead end-to-end execution of a portfolio of 2–4 complex data engineering programs, ensuring alignment to business priorities, technical strategy, and customer impact
-
Own program planning and delivery, including scope, timelines, resource planning, and sequencing of work across multiple teams
-
Drive execution rigor across programs by proactively managing dependencies, risks, and blockers, and implementing mitigation plans to ensure on-time, high-quality delivery
-
Provide clear, data-driven visibility into program health, including progress, risks, and key metrics, to stakeholders at all levels
-
Partner with engineering and product teams to ensure strong roadmap planning (12–18 months), high-quality requirements, and effective intake and prioritization of new work
-
Embed best practices across the software development lifecycle, including CI/CD, SRE, and developer experience, to improve delivery efficiency and reliability
-
Connect work across programs and domains, identifying synergies, integration points, and potential conflicts across engineering, product, and business functions
-
Champion continuous improvement by streamlining processes, enhancing execution models, and scaling best practices across teams
-
Communicate with clarity and influence, using a combination of storytelling and metrics to drive alignment and decision-making
